EXTRA WALK: Wittenham Clumps and the Thames Path

Saturday 16 April (Easter vacation)

From Didcot Parkway station we will walk up to Wittenham Clumps, small hills with good views over the surrounding flat landscape, then descend to nearby Days Lock on the River Thames, and follow the river (Thames Path National Trail) for the rest of the walk.

Each person individually will have several options (listed below) for how far to walk, as near the river are several railway stations on the Oxford-Paddington line. The led walk will be as far as Reading, so challenging options are available. Some of the shorter options involve up to 2km after leaving the led walk (included in the distances shown). This will involve only straightforward route-finding, and appropriate map printouts will be provided.
